Lesson Plan in Math 2

July 5, 2018 ( 10:45 – 11:35)

I. OBJECTIVE:
With the help of group activity, the Grade 2 pupils will be able to:
a. identify the ways on how to order number up to 1000 from least to greatest and vice
versa;
b. participate actively in the activities of the lesson;

II. SUBJECT MATTER:

Topic: Ordering Numbers Up to 1000 From Least to Greatest and Vice Versa
Materials: strip of papers with numbers, flash cards, popsicle stick
References: Mathematics: Kagamitan ng mga Mag-aaral ( Sinugbuanong Binisaya)
pp. 31-33
Values Integration: Cooperation

III. PROCEDURE:
A. Engage
The teacher will begin by:
- A short recap about the previous lesson.
-Group game
-The class will be group into 4 and each group will be provided
with different bundles of popsicle stick .

Each member helps in counting the number of popsicle sticks in every bundle
and they will going to arrange the bundle from least to the greatest number.
The leader writes the numbers on the board which are arrange in order from
least to greatest.

5 8 10 11 15
Valuing: Which group did it quickly and correctly? Why?
What must one do when working with a group? ( Work Cooperatively)
The teacher will explain more on the value of cooperation.
B. Explore:
The teacher will call 4 pupils in a class and will be given a strip of paper with
number. She will tell the pupils to write the numbers on the board.

236 102 408 601


The teacher will let her pupils to arrange the following numbers from least to
greatest.
C. Explain:
The teacher will ask the following question:
What is the least number? (102)
The next number? ( 236)
How about the greatest number? (601)
How are the number arranged? ( from least to greatest)
In what ways does counting start? ( least number)
The teacher will now rearrange the number on the board and she will let her
pupils read and observe the order of the numbers.
How are the numbers arranged? ( from greatest to least)
In what number does counting start? ( greatest number)
D. Elaborate:
The teacher will provide another example .
( Board work)
She will let the pupils read and
arrange the numbers from least to greatest on the board.
With the same sets of numbers arrange them in order from greatest to least.
E. Evaluate:
Seatwork Activity.

Arrange the Following Numbers From Least To Greatest

1. ) 236 536 336 136 = ____ ____ ____ ____

2.) 678 435 143 416 = ____ ____ ____ ____

Arrange the Following Numbers From Greatest To Least

1. ) 990 786 336 542 = ____ ____ ____ ____

2.) 341 690 202 823 = ____ ____ ____ ____

Let the pupils answer Buluhaton 1 in Learner’s Material.
